Design of a highly sensitive and versatile membrane-based immunosensor using a Cu-free click reaction.

Hiroto OkuyamaYukari KodamaKazuya TakemuraHiroki YamashitaYuhei OshibaTakeo Yamaguchi
Published in: Analytical methods : advancing methods and applications (2023)
A highly sensitive immunosensor is developed using membrane pores as the recognition interface. In this sensor, a Cu-free click reaction is used to efficiently immobilize antibodies, and the sensor inhibits the adsorption of nonspecific proteins that degrade sensitivity. Furthermore, the sensor demonstrates rapid interleukin-6 detection in the picogram per milliliter range.
